BROOKS BROTHERS OPENS NEW STORE IN NEW YORK CITY’S FINANCIAL DISTRICT
Brooks Brothers celebrated the opening of its newest location in Manhattan, a 10,000-square-foot, two-level space in the Western Union Telegraph Building at 195 Broadway and Fulton Street. If the location weren’t prime enough, the soaring stone columns, coffered ceilings, and travertine floors offer a grand shopping experience that lives up to the 207-year-old brand’s mystique. The location is blocks away from the location of the Brooks Brothers store at One Liberty Plaza, which was decimated by the 9/11 terrorist attacks.
The opening party, held on Wednesday, May 28th, was immediately followed by an intimate dinner at Nobu Downtown, located literally across the hall from the store in the same building. Brooks Brothers CEO Ken Ohashi (an MR Award Honoree for 2025) hosted the dinner, which included brand owner Authentic Brands Group’s Jarrod Weber, Brooks Brothers designer Michael Bastian and VP, Marketing & Public Relations Arthur Wayne, as well as industry press and fashion influencers.
